What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1910.1200(e)(1):Employer had not developed or implemented a written hazard communication program which at included the requirements outlined in 29 CFR 1910.1200(e)(1)(i) and (e)(1)(ii): (Construction Reference: 1926.59)  At 9094 Freedom Court, Lenexa, Kansas, employees engaged in roofing activities were exposed to dermatitis and burn hazards from exposure to hazardous chemicals. Employer had not developed nor implemented a written hazard communication program to ensure employees are aware of the hazards associated with the chemicals with which they work. Hazardous chemicals used at the site included but were not limited to gasoline.

29 CFR 1910.1200(g)(8): The employer did not maintain copies of the required material safety data sheets for each hazardous chemical in the workplace: (Construction Reference: 1926.59)  At 9094 Freedom Court, Lenexa, Kansas, employees engaged in roofing activities were exposed to dermatitis and burn hazards from exposure to hazardous chemicals such as but not limited to gasoline in that the employer did not maintain a copy of the required safety data sheet for gasoline.
